The CW has set midseason premiere dates for a new mystery series, the final episodes of a veteran comedy show, Season 3 of a Canadian import and a special about some extraordinary American women.
The series premiere of Sherlock & Daughter, starring David Thewlis as Arthur Conan Doyle’s beloved detective and Blu Hunt as his offspring, is set for Wednesday, April 16.
Season 3 of Sullivan’s Crossing, starring Morgan Kohan, Chad Michael Murray and Scott Patterson, launches Wednesday, May 7, and the final episodes of the climactic fourth season of sitcom Children Ruin Everything — led by Meaghan Rath and Aaron Abrams — will start with back-to-back episodes on Wednesday, June 18.
